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ve positioning accuracy when a horizontal coil bobbin is inserted into an integrated core around which vertically deflecting coil is wound by directly connecting the protrusion provided on the horizontal coil bobbin to the inner surface of the integrated core. CONSTITUTION:Four protrusions 10 are provided on the bell-shape taper part 1a of a horizontal coil bobbin 1. When an integrated core 5 around which a vertically deflecting coil is wound into a saddle form is fitted to the bobbin 1, the front end of each protrusion 10 is brought into contact with the inner surface of the core 5, which is held therewith accurately, by providing the protrusion 10 on the outer surface of the bobbin 1. When a small protrusion is provided on the front end of each protrusion 10, and when the core is to be inserted, since the core is pressed in while the small protrusion is abrased, even when the inner diameter of the core 5 is uneven, this unevenness can be absorbed, and the core 5 is held more accurately and more easily. A spacer made of rubber is not needed, and the positioning accuracy when the bobbin 1 is inserted into the core 5 can thus be improved.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a deflection yoke used in cathode ray tubes such as displays and televisions.

The method of assembling such a conventional deflection yoke is as follows. First, the vertical deflection coil 6 has a saddle shape that creates a desired magnetic field distribution on the inner surface of the magnetic core 9 while hooking the enamel wire on the large-diameter end side hook 7 and the small-diameter end side hook 8 of the integrated core 5 in order. Wound to form. On the other hand, the horizontal deflection coil 2 hooks the enamel wire on the large-diameter end side hook 3 and the small-diameter end side vertical groove 4 of the horizontal coil bobbin 1 in order, similarly to the vertical deflection coil 6.
The inner surface is wound so as to form a saddle shape that produces the desired magnetic field distribution. When the winding is completed, the horizontal coil bobbin 1 is fixed in one direction by inserting the horizontal deflection bobbin 1 in one direction from the large diameter end side of the integrated core 5 wound with the vertical deflection coil 6 to the small diameter end side. Complete. As described above, the use of the integral bobbin 1 and the integral core 5 has the advantages that the number of parts is smaller than in the case of the divided bobbin and the core, and the unidirectional assembly is possible and the assembly is easy.

As described above, in the conventional deflection yoke, the horizontal coil bobbin 1 is inserted in one direction from the large diameter end portion side of the integrated core 5 to the small diameter end portion side, and at that time, the horizontal coil bobbin 1 is inserted. Since a rubber spacer is used for positioning between the core coil 5 and the integrated core 5, the thickness of the rubber spacer is difficult to control and the manufacturing variation is large. However, there is a problem in that the accuracy of positioning with respect to each other becomes low, and convergence on the screen is likely to occur, and it takes a lot of time to adjust convergence in a subsequent process.

Example 1. An emb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S. FIG. 1 is a cross-sectional view, and FIG. 2 is a side view showing the horizontal coil bobbin of FIG. In the figure, 10 is a trumpet-shaped taper portion 1a of the horizontal coil bobbin 1.
Are four protrusions provided on the. When the four protrusions 10 are provided on the outer surface of the horizontal coil bobbin 1 in this manner, when the integrated core 5 in which the vertical deflection coil is wound in a saddle type is attached to the horizontal coil bobbin 1, the tips of the four protrusions 10 are attached. Is in contact with the inner surface of the integrated core 5, and the integrated core 5 can be held accurately.

Example 2. When the small protrusions 11 are provided at the tips of the four protrusions 10 in the first embodiment as shown in FIGS. 3 and 4, when the integrated core 5 is inserted, the small protrusions 1
Since 1 is press-fitted while being scraped off, even if the inner diameter of the integrated core 5 varies, it can be absorbed and the integrated core 5 can be held more accurately and easily.
